找回密码
 立即注册

QQ登录

【GPIO】滑条控制全彩LED颜色

来源: 奥松-Neil 2017-2-7 16:15 显示全部楼层 |阅读模式
1、实验目的:
使用python2的TKinter库建立三个滑条,通过拖动滑条,分别控制RGB LED的三个颜色

2、实验环境:
实验硬件:
* Raspberry Pi 3 控制器套件
*
全彩 LED(共阴极) 1个
* 470欧电阻 3个
* 实验连接线若干
软件环境
* 操作系统:2016-09-23-raspbian-jessie
* 编译器:Python2

3、硬件连接
Raspberry  Pi GPIO PIN  标号图:
硬件连接示意图:
11.jpg
实物接线图:
12.jpg

游客,如果您要查看本帖隐藏内容请回复
6、代码运行
  • 输入指令:cd Alsrobot,进入Alsrobot目录
  • 输入指令:ls,查看当前目录下都有哪些文件
  • 输入指令:sudo python2 gui_sliderRGB.py,单击回车,运行相应程序

效果如图所示,分别拖动RGB滑条,就可以改变RGB LED红、绿、蓝的亮度

13.jpg

7、简要说明
本实验中的代码与“【GPIO】通过滑条改变PWM信号脉宽实验基本相同,只是这里建立了三个滑条,分别控制RGB LED的三个颜色,实验中使用的是共阴极RGB LED,所以注意要将它们的公共引脚(较长的引脚)连接到Raspberry Pi的GND引脚,这种情况下滑条从0 - 100,相应颜色的光是从灭到亮的,你也可以使用共阳极的RGB LED来进行实验,只是接线的时候要注意,公共引脚就要连接到3.3V上,并且滑条控制的时候,从0滑动到100,相应颜色的光是从亮到灭的。

回复

使用道具 举报

大神点评18

油条C 2017-2-14 12:37 显示全部楼层
好好的研究一下
回复 支持 反对

使用道具 举报

勇哥 2017-2-14 16:38 显示全部楼层
。。。。。。
回复

使用道具 举报

回复学习
回复

使用道具 举报

guohua3544 2017-3-13 11:42 显示全部楼层
看看dsfsdfsfsfsafsdfsfs
回复 支持 反对

使用道具 举报

wang11876 2017-3-20 14:56 显示全部楼层
FFFFFFFFFFFFFFFFFFFFFFFFFFFFFFF
回复 支持 反对

使用道具 举报

nyebo1911 2017-4-24 12:13 显示全部楼层
谢谢分享内容。
回复 支持 反对

使用道具 举报

长舌怪 2017-5-2 08:27 显示全部楼层
图文并茂,讲解的非常清楚,复习学习
回复 支持 反对

使用道具 举报

yzw 2017-5-30 13:46 显示全部楼层
好好的研究一下
回复 支持 反对

使用道具 举报

勿以泪惧 2017-11-24 17:18 显示全部楼层
学习中ING
回复

使用道具 举报

您可能感兴趣的文章

您需要登录后才可以回帖 登录 | 立即注册

关注0

粉丝8

帖子147

发布主题
社区热门 MORE+
    社区热帖 MORE+